Producer/songwriter Christian Berishaj was born in the greater Detroit area and quickly developed a fascination with music and performance. He started recording his own music at age 12 and by the time he was 18 he'd gone through various different bands and projects, including recording an album as Love Arcade on which he wrote and performed every sound. Love Arcade was eventually signed to Atlantic records, with a self-titled album on which Berishaj was the sole performer coming out in 2006. A touring band was assembled around the project but none of the members ever played on any recordings and the group broke up after three years. Following Love Arcade, Berishaj relocated to Los Angeles and worked briefly under the moniker Christian TV, licensing songs in various films and television and signing a deal with Universal Motown Records. The label folded and Berishaj again reconfigured, taking on the name JMSN and producing more R&B inspired music, taking a decided step away from the pop leanings of previous projects. He self-released his debut Priscilla in early 2012, earning high praise from press and his artistic contemporaries as well. He followed with the next year with the Pllaje EP and a lengthy tour. JMSN spent much of 2014 prepping his next full-length, The Blue Album. The Blue Album's release date was delayed but eventually saw release in late 2014. ~ Fred Thomas

The lyrics of JMSN's "Love Myself" convey a sense of self-awareness and introspection. The singer opens by telling their partner that there is "nothing left" for them in the relationship anymore. There is no uncertainty or ambiguity - they are not offering any false hope or trying to string their partner along. They acknowledge that they are not in a place where they can commit to someone else, and it would be best for their partner to move on.
The second verse is where the true emotional heart of the song is exposed. The singer reveals that they are aware of their own mental state - they are "crazy" and fear that their partner will come to hate them. The line "See I don't love myself" is incredibly powerful - it's a confession of low self-esteem and a lack of self-love. This is why they know that they cannot expect someone else to do for them what they cannot do for themselves. It's a vulnerable and honest admission of their own shortcomings and an acknowledgement that they need to work on themselves before they can be a good partner to someone else.
What makes "Love Myself" such a moving and impactful song is how universal these emotional experiences are. Whether it's insecurity about one's own mental health or struggles with self-love and self-esteem, many listeners will be able to relate to the emotions that JMSN is expressing. The stripped-down musical arrangement adds to the raw, emotional feeling of the song - the focus is entirely on the lyrics and JMSN's expressive, soulful vocals.
